Output ec0357425f40294a3ed35bd0e79054027eedf944d866061bc538b17cf12d098d:10

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e72f8ab7e9877056e5b9a7aa7190a26b678d3b84 OP_EQUAL
address
3NmQy87pYSffwFCJU8ySh8MEd7QwFX6EVZ
transaction
ec0357425f40294a3ed35bd0e79054027eedf944d866061bc538b17cf12d098d
spent
true